Description
Digital Concrete Test Hammer is a non-destructive testing (NDT) instrument used to evaluate the surface hardness and estimate the compressive strength of concrete. Utilizing advanced electronic sensing technology, the device automatically records rebound values, calculates test results, and stores measurement data for quick analysis and reporting.
Compared to conventional mechanical rebound hammers, the digital version offers improved accuracy, data storage capabilities, and easy transfer of test results. It is widely used for on-site quality assessment of concrete structures, bridges, buildings, tunnels, pavements, and precast elements.
Designed for field and laboratory applications, the Digital Concrete Test Hammer provides fast, reliable, and repeatable measurements while minimizing operator errors.

Technical Specifications
| Parameter | Specification |
|---|---|
| Test Method | Rebound Hammer Method |
| Display | Digital LCD |
| Data Storage | Internal Memory |
| Communication | USB / Bluetooth (Model Dependent) |
| Impact Energy | 2.207 Nm (Type N) |
| Strength Range | 10–100 MPa (Typical) |
| Power Supply | Rechargeable Battery |
| Data Export | Excel / PDF Reports |
| Standards | ASTM C805, EN 12504-2, IS 13311 (Part 2) |
